How much do math anal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for math analyst in Connecticut is $69,692.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$49,900.00 and $82,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Math Analyst vs Data Analyst?

AspectMath AnalystData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's or higher in Mathematics, Statistics, or related fieldBachelor's or higher in Statistics, Data Science, or related field
Work EnvironmentResearch labs, financial firms, tech companiesBusiness, marketing, finance, healthcare sectors
Employer & Industry UsageFinance, academia, government agenciesCorporate, consulting, tech industries
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

Math Analysts focus on advanced mathematical modeling and theoretical analysis, often working in research or finance. Data Analysts primarily interpret data to inform business decisions, working across various industries. While both roles require strong analytical skills, Math Analysts typically need deeper mathematical expertise, whereas Data Analysts emphasize data handling and visualization skills.

What do math analysts do?

Math analysts analyze data, develop mathematical models, and apply statistical techniques to solve complex problems across various industries. They often use tools like Excel, MATLAB, or R and require strong analytical skills and a background in mathematics or related fields.

What We Look For In a SAT Math Tutor
  • Advanced Math Content Mastery: Deep knowledge of SAT Math topics including linear equations, systems, inequalities, algebraic expressions, quadratic functions, exponential growth, ratios and proportions, percentages, data interpretation, statistics, geometry, trigonometry, and complex numbers. Ability to explain calculator-permitted versus no-calculator strategies and grid-in answer formatting for score maximization.
  • Strategic Problem-Solving & Reasoning: Skilled at teaching multiple solution pathways, estimation techniques, and pattern recognition in SAT math questions. Guides students through word problem translation, equation setup, graph interpretation, and identifying fastest solution methods. Emphasizes strategic approach selection (plugging in numbers, backsolving, algebraic methods) and time management across 58 questions.
  • Test Strategy & Adaptive Instruction: Familiar with SAT Math question distribution, common traps (misreading questions, sign errors), and high-frequency topics. Adapts instruction through timed practice sections, error analysis, formula sheet creation, and targeted drills for weak areas. Requires minimum SAT Math score of 720 and proven track record helping students improve math subscores significantly.
  • Effective Teaching Methods: Ability to identify concepts students commonly struggle with, explain material using multiple approaches, and adapt instruction to meet individual learning needs and styles.
